With his winning '92 Camaro, Kye Kelley heads back to the bayou to defend his title and build a crew of the fastest racers in the Southeast. However, with a target on his back, Kelley must quickly adjust to life at the top.
Kye Kelley invites three new drivers to try out for the top-five big-tire list. Kye tries to take the number one spot back from Scott Taylor. Bobby must also defend his top spot against number two, Brandon Smith.

Kye wants to call out another top team, and the perfect opponent is Houston, with James "Birdman" Finney, David Bird Jones and Barefoot Ronnie Pace. The NOLA team barely tied Houston last year, and both sides want a rematch.

After a win over Houston, the New Orleans team is ready for bigger competition. Kye and the big-tire list head to Texas for DigNight, a single-elimination shootout with a prize of more than $12,000.

After a disappointing showing at DigNight, Kye decides to shake up the big-tire list again. He brings in newcomer David Bird Jones, a Houston transplant, along with Shane Lester and gives them a shot at the top five.

The New Orleans small-tire list gets its second shakeup of the season when Scott rolls out a small-tire car. Shannon hopes to mount a comeback, while Brandon is determined to win against unbeaten number one Bobby.

Kye accepts a call out from a smack-talking Georgia team. The crew travels to Savannah to meet a team that features cocky Andy Mac, veteran Willy Dog and team leader Jeff Miller, who drives a pro-mod Camaro called Bumblebee.

Kye wants the top big-tire spot back from Scott, but when Barry calls Kye out first, tensions boil. Bobby organizes a small-tire shootout, bringing in top racers from around the US for a single-elimination tournament.

After a successful season, the NOLA racers decide to loosen things up with a crash-up derby, using junker cars towing trailers. They find rides at the salvage yard and swipe trailers from family for the big showdown.
